SUMMARY:USET Water Distribution Operator ABC Class I Certification Course
DESCRIPTION:USET Water Distribution Operator ABC Class I Certification Course\nSession participants will learn regulations\, operator math and chemistry\, and specific distribution processes in detail. Other chapters cover water use and system design\, water mains\, hydrants and valves\, water system supply\, security and public relations. The course will closely follow the “Need to Know” criteria to pass the ABC Class I Distribution certification exam. \nThe course will begin on Thursday\, July 22\, 2021 and continue weekly until September 24 with time off for various summer holidays. The trainer is a subject matter expert and has been successfully training the utilities workforce for many years. DESCRIPTION:In recognition of the bold and visionary leadership of our founding member Tribal Nations and leaders who set forth the mission of USET back in 1969\, we celebrate “USET Founders Day” on October 5 every year. USET/USET SPF offices are closed. \nLearn more about USET Founders Day.

SUMMARY:USET OERM Safe Drinking Water Act Regulatory Training Seminars
DESCRIPTION:  \n \nUSET Office of Environmental Resource Managements Presents\nSafe Drinking Water Act Regulatory Training Seminars \n  \nLearn how to implement Safe Drinking Water Act regulations and obtain convenient help guides to achieve compliance excellence. \nThe various seminars will discuss items\, such as: \n\nHow lead testing in schools and daycare centers is being offered through USET – learn about the program\nNew requirements by EPA for Lead and Copper monitoring – join us to develop your strategy\nHow the emerging pollutant PFAS will affect your utility – join us for an engaging conversation and then sign up for drinking water monitoring offered by USET to help you understand the levels of PFAS in your system and if new regulations may require increased treatment technologies to be applied.\n\nSeminar Schedule: \n\nSeminar 1: Update on Emerging Pollutant PFAS November 17\, 2021 at 10:00 am Eastern\nSeminar 2: Update on the New Lead and Copper Rule December 1\, 2021 at 10:00 am Eastern\nSeminar 3: Public Notification Rule and Easy to Use Templates December 8\, 2021 at 10:00 am Eastern\nSeminar 4: Stage 1 and Stage 2 Disinfection Byproduct Rule December 15\, 2021 at 10:00 am Eastern\n\nOne CEU per seminar will be provided for USET member Tribal Nation staff. \nRegister \nIf you have any questions\, please email Jennifer Bennett at jbennett@usetinc.org.

SUMMARY:Martin Luther King\, Jr. Day
DESCRIPTION:Martin Luther King\, Jr. Day \nWe are honoring the achievements of Dr. Martin Luther King\, Jr. today and the USET/USET SPF offices are closed. Dr. King was the most influential of African American civil rights leaders during the 1960s\, he was instrumental in the passage of the Civil Rights Act of 1964\, which outlawed discrimination in public accommodations\, facilities\, and employment\, and the Voting Rights Act of 1965. SUMMARY:Reclaiming Native Psychological Brilliance - BH ECHO Clinic
DESCRIPTION:“Introduction to the Reclaiming Native Psychological Brilliance Series” – January Clinic\nhosted by USET Tribal Health Program Support\nWe invite you and your staff to participate in the new Tribal Behavioral Health ECHO series\, Reclaiming Native Psychological Brilliance\, launching on January 25\, 2022. Native Psychological Brilliance refers to the intelligence\, strengths\, balance\, innate resources\, and resilience of Native people. This no-cost telehealth series will be held throughout 2022 on the fourth Tuesday of every month at 1:00 pm Central/2:00 pm Eastern. Each session will be one hour in length. \nWho should attend? Tribal Nation health directors\, clinic staff\, counselors\, social workers\, physicians\, nurses\, and anyone supporting Tribal Nation citizens through the behavioral health/mental health sector are welcome to join. \nThe one-hour Reclaiming Native Psychological Brilliance virtual series will provide an opportunity for participants to: \n\nGain skills on strength-based approaches in partnership with Native People to enhance Native behavioral health\, and\nDiscuss ways that Native brilliance is demonstrated and supports behavioral health\, and\nLearn about Native brilliance examples to share with behavioral health and other health care staff\, as well as with local Tribal Nation citizens\n\nThe concept of Native psychological brilliance will be celebrated through Native music videos and Native spoken word performances as part of each session of the Reclaiming Native Psychological Brilliance series. \nContinuing education credits will be provided. \nRegister in advance for the session. \nFor questions\, please contact Bryan Hendrix\, USET THPS Quality Improvement Analyst\, at bhendrix@usetinc.org.

SUMMARY:USET Hepatitis C Project ECHO Clinic
DESCRIPTION:USET Hepatitis C Project ECHO Clinic\npresented by\nUSET Tribal Health Program Support \nThe one-hour virtual clinics allow for primary care clinicians to collaborate with a team of specialists to learn best practices for treating and curing hepatitis C (HCV). These clinics include case presentations\, recommendations from expert faculty\, and a didactic session. \nWho should attend? Indian Health Service staff\, Urban Indian and Tribal Nation clinicians/ staff\, and health care professionals \nWhen? The second Monday of every month at 11:00 am – 12:00 pm Central/12:00 pm – 1:00 pm Eastern \nBenefits of attending\, and presenting a deidentified case  include: \n\nDiscussing HCV treatment options for each case from leading treatment experts\nCollaborating with other clinicians from Tribal Nations within the Nashville Area Office region and beyond\nReceiving written recommendation options for each specific case presented\n\nTo join\, please click the link below at the time of the meeting: \nhttps://echo.zoom.us/j/880735403 \nIf you would like to present a case\, please complete the case form and send to Bryan Hendrix via email (bhendrix@usetinc.org).
